Can Coatings Market Size & Trends 2026-2035

Can Coatings Market Trends, Sales Volume, Production Cost, Fulfillment Cycle Time, Export & Import Flows, Pricing Metrics, Recycling Rate, Adoption Rates, and Distribution Performance

The global can coatings market, valued at USD 525.25 billion in 2025, is anticipated to reach USD 859.66 billion by 2035, growing at a CAGR of 5.05% over the next decade. It includes deep-dives into regional dynamics where North America leads, Asia-Pacific shows the fastest CAGR, and Europe, Latin America, and MEA see strong adoption of recyclable and BPA-free coatings. The report presents competitive benchmarking, value chain and raw material sourcing analysis, global trade flows, and detailed profiles of manufacturers and suppliers across the coating ecosystem.
